5 10.4 Heat transfer in combustion chamber
1. heat transfer through a cylinder wall

6 10.4 Heat transfer in combustion chamber
Cooling of piston Convection to the oil Conduction by the piston rings Conduction down the connecting rod to the oil

8 10.6 Engine operating variables on heat transfer
Engine size: larger engine more efficient Engine speed: as engine speed is increased, heat transfer increases Load: as load is increased mass flow rate of air and fuel goes up and heat transfer goes up.
